Session Topic: Flank Play (Defending)

Principles: Delay, Depth & cover, Concentration, Balance & Cover

Field: 2/3rd's of field as shown above (zone 1 & 2)

Equipment

1 large goal, 2 small goals, cones, soccer balls, 7 x yellow pinnies, 8 black pinnies, 1 green GK pinnie

Instructions

Both teams set up as 4-3-3 (adjusted) formation. Game starts as an 8v7 with the black team (attacking) looking to score in the full size goal, and then yellow team (defending) to score in the small target goals. Ball stats from left CB who then initiates the attack. Regular laws of the game apply except corners and throw-ins. Black team starts with ball at restarts. If GK picks up the bal - yellow can counter in small target goals.

Coaching Points

As the black team works to play down the flank to their RW to score on the large net, the yellow team will look to press. The LW will look to delay the black RB in an effort to stop forward play. If the ball gets played forward to the RW - the LW will press from behind and disallow any passed backwards. The CM will provide cover for the LB who will press the player with the ball. If the RW takes a first touch inside or looks to move inside, the CM can then press and the LB will drop back into a covering position. The two CBs will shift over to balance out the back line. Player pressing will attempt to stop any shots on net.

Defending team is to stay compact while dictacting the play wide. Ensure communication from supporting players is constant (including the GK).

UPON regaining possession of the ball, the yellow team will look to score in one of the two smaller target nets.

Progression

Add another black player to make it an 8v8.
